Learn how Apache Answer and LearnHouse differ in their key features, development activity, technology stack and community adoption, so you can decide which of these community building platforms is best for you.
Stars
Forks
Last commit
Repository age
License
Self-hosted
Auto-fetched .

Auto-fetched .

Both Apache Answer and LearnHouse have their unique strengths and serve similar purposes effectively. Consider your specific needs regarding popularity, activity, technology, maturity, licensing and features when making your decision.
Apache Answer significantly outpaces LearnHouse in community adoption with 15,477 stars compared to 1,423 stars on GitHub. This 10.9x difference suggests Apache Answer has a much larger and more active community. In terms of developer contributions, Apache Answer has 1,309 forks, indicating strong developer engagement.
Both projects show recent activity, with Apache Answer last updated 6 days ago and LearnHouse 14 hours ago.
Both tools share common technology foundations, being built with JavaScript, CSS, Bash, Typescript, JSX. However, they differ in their additional technology choices: Apache Answer uses SCSS, Golang while LearnHouse leverages Python, Next.js.
Both projects started around the same time, with Apache Answer beginning 4 years ago and LearnHouse 4 years ago.
The projects use different licenses: Apache Answer is licensed under Apache-2.0 while LearnHouse uses AGPL-3.0. Consider the licensing requirements when choosing for your project.
Both tools serve similar use cases in Community Building Platforms. However, they also have distinct specializations: Apache Answer also focuses on Q&A Platforms while LearnHouse extends into Course Creation Platforms, Learning Management Systems (LMS).
Both Apache Answer and LearnHouse offer self-hosting capabilities, giving you full control over your data and infrastructure.